Arrest Made in Allure Night Club Shooting 6-7-2019

UPDATE:
The Dover Police Department has arrested Naquan Ingram (35) for the June 2nd shooting that occurred at Allure Night Club.  Ingram was identified by officers who obtained video surveillance from the area that the incident occurred.  Ingram was arrested without incident at the Dover Probation and Parole office by the U.S. Marshal’s First State Fugitive Task Force on June 6th, 2019 and committed to SCI in default of $174,000 cash bond on the following charges:
-Assault 1st Degree
-Reckless Endangering 1st Degree
-Carry Concealed Deadly Weapon
-Possession of Firearm During Commission of Felony
-Possession of Firearm by Person Prohibited
-Illegal Gang Participation

Incident/Complaint#:  50-19-16687

Date/Time:  Sunday, June 2nd, 2019 at 1:57AM

Location: Allure Night Club Parking Lot, 865 N. DuPont Highway, Dover, DE

Officer Releasing Information:   M/Cpl. Mark Hoffman, Public Information Officer

Narrative: 

The Dover Police Department is investigating a shooting that left a 38-year-old male injured as he was leaving Allure Night Club.  Dover Police were notified by staff at a nearby hospital that a gunshot victim had arrived by private vehicle to the emergency room.  Officers learned that as the victim was leaving Allure Night Club, he observed a group of people arguing, and heard gunfire.  At that time, the victim was struck in the upper torso and was then transported to the hospital by a friend.  The victim’s injuries were considered non-life threatening.
